The Whiskey Live is a series of concerts presented annually by The Whiskey bar as a celebration of New Zealand Music Month each May. Featuring a broad spectrum of New Zealand musicians performing one of a kind, limited capacity shows; The Whiskey Live is fast becoming a headline attraction of New Zealand Music Month each year.
For three decades, the multi-talented, multi-instrumentalist Don McGlashan has captured the ears and hearts of people in New Zealand and around the world. Don was the driving force behind From Scratch, Blam Blam Blam, The Front Lawn and The Mutton Birds and his work continues to offer the soundtracks to our lives.
Don, the singer and main songwriter in The Mutton Birds from 1991 to 2002, released 4 NZ top ten albums (two platinum) and two top five singles, including one No. 1 single "The Heater". His song “Anchor Me” won the APRA Silver scroll in 1993. The group signed to Virgin Records UK in 1995, and were based in London from then until 1999, touring all over the world. The band’s third album, "Envy Of Angels" (1997), made the U.K. Sunday Times ten best records of the year list.
Supporting McGlashan is Greg Fleming, an Auckland based singer/songwriter - he performs live with his band The Trains (Dom Blaazer: keyboards, vocals; John Segovia: electric guitar, vocals; Earl Robertson: drums, vocals; & Andrew B. White: bass, vocals).
Often cited as being a pioneer of ‘alt.country’ rock in New Zealand, over a decade before the genre developed the ‘cred’ it now has, Greg stands apart with an extensive and timeless body of work.
